Abstract

A method and apparatus for paging a wireless transmit / receive unit (WTRU) in a CELL_PCH and URA_PCH states are disclosed. A WTRU may send an indication of an enhanced paging channel (PCH) capability of receiving a high speed downlink shared channel (HS-DSCH) in CELL_PCH and URA_PCH states, for example, in a CELL UPDATE message, a URA UPDATE message, or a UTRAN MOBILITY INFORMATION CONFIRM message. A drift radio network controller (DRNC) may receive an indication whether the WTRU has an enhanced PCH capability from a serving RNC and page the WTRU based on the indication. An RNC may page the WTRU over both an HS-DSCH and a PCH / secondary common control physical channel (S-CCPCH) if a WTRU capability is not known. The WTRU may monitor both an HS-DSCH and a PCH / S-CCPCH. The WTRU may configure reception over an HS-DSCH based on the capability of the SRNC or configuration from the network.

technical field [0001] This application relates to wireless communications. Background technique [0002] Four Radio Resource Control (RRC) states are defined in conventional 3rd Generation Partnership Project (3GPP) specifications. These RRC states are CELL_DCH state, CELL_FACH state, CELL_PCH state and URA_PCH state. Improvements to the legacy CELL_FACH and CELL / URA_PCH states have been added in the 3GPP specifications to improve the overall quality of experience (QoE) experienced by end users. CELL_FACH and CELL_URA_PCH improvements reduce state transition delays, as well as overall signaling latencies, by using High Speed ​​Downlink Packet Access Resource (HSDPA) attempts in CELL_FACH and CELL / URA_PCH states. [0003] After introducing the enhanced CELL_FACH state, the High Speed ​​Downlink Shared Channel (HS-DSCH) can be used in the CELL_FACH state.
